#73338b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73338b is composed of 45.1% red, 20%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.3%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 283.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 37.3%. #73338b color hex could be obtained by blending #e666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#73338b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08040a is the darkest color, while #fdf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#73338b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5f5f is the less saturated color, while #8707b7 is the most saturated one.
